*REVERSE PROPORTION*
muminat

9514 1404 393

Answer:

  33.3%

Step-by-step explanation:

The selling price of £42 is (1 +40%) times the total purchase price.

  1.40 × purchase price = £42

  purchase price = £42/1.40 = £30

The total profit is 40% of this, so is ...

  £30 × 40% = £12

The purchase price of the skirt is ...

  total cost - glove cost = skirt cost = £30 -3 = £27

The profit on the skirt is ...

  total profit - glove profit = skirt profit = £12 -100% × £3 = £9

Then the percentage profit on the skirt is ...

  skirt profit % = skirt profit / skirt cost × 100% = £9/£27 × 100% = 33.3%

The percentage profit on the cost of the skirt was 33.3%.

Un móvil azul de 573 g se encuentra en movimiento sobre un carril metálico. Si sobre el móvil, el resorte ejerce una fuerza haci
ad-work [718]

Answer:

The total mechanical energy is 0.712 J.

Step-by-step explanation:

A blue 573 g mobile is moving on a metal rail. If on the mobile, the spring exerts a force to the right of modulus 0.85 N and in the indicated position the kinetic energy of the mobile-spring system is 0.47 J and its elastic potential energy is 0.242 J. Determine the mechanical energy of the system mobile-spring in the position shown as indicated in the figure.

The total mechanical energy is given by the sum of the kinetic energy and the potential energy.

Kinetic energy = 0.47 J

Potential energy = 0.242 J

The total mechanical energy is

T = 0.47 + 0.242 = 0.712 J
